The Body Doesn't Heal Without Sleep
When we rest, our bodies enter into repair mode. Muscles recuperate, cells regenerate, and our immune system enhances. It's a time when the body detoxes and recovers. Yet when rest is stopped or when it's continually poor quality, this whole procedure is disturbed.
Gradually, an absence of appropriate rest can cause weakened immunity, making you extra susceptible to illnesses. Also injuries recover much more gradually when you're sleep-deprived. Persistent bad sleep has actually additionally been linked to a higher risk of creating lasting wellness problems like heart problem, diabetes mellitus, and hypertension.
A good night's rest isn't a luxury-- it's a necessity for the body to function correctly.

Emotional Resilience Depends on Quality Rest
Ever before notice exactly how your patience frays after a bad evening's sleep? That's no coincidence. Sleep and feelings are deeply intertwined.
When you're well-rested, you're much better outfitted to regulate your feelings and reply to stressful circumstances. Without rest, little troubles can feel overwhelming. This occurs since the mind's emotional center ends up being over active, while the area in charge of abstract thought slows down.
Mood swings, irritability, stress and anxiety, and also depressive episodes can all be connected to bad rest. Psychological security relies upon obtaining regular, deep remainder. And if interfered with rest comes to be a pattern, it might be time to discover if a much deeper concern goes to play.

Hormonal Imbalance and Weight Gain
Yes, sleep impacts your weight-- and not even if you're too worn out to strike the gym.
Sleep plays a significant duty in regulating the hormones that regulate cravings and metabolism. When you're sleep-deprived, your body creates even more ghrelin (the cravings hormonal agent) and less leptin (the hormone that makes you feel full). This discrepancy usually results in boosted cravings and junk food selections.
Additionally, chronic poor sleep can interfere with insulin sensitivity, boosting the danger of kind 2 diabetic issues. Your body's capacity to manage blood sugar level counts greatly on rest, making it necessary for total metabolic wellness.
